Owners of a Fritz 13 license and serial number respectively, have now the opportunity to participate in a beta test of a new, amazing Fritz feature:

The Engine Cloud

http://www.engine-cloud.com/

The download page (free download but requires a Fritz 13 license number to work) has the current file date, so you can see if a new beta is available. I was testing the version from May 14th today, and despite some minor details, it works fine. As for now, I saw that cloud engines can be used for analysis (incl. Let's Check analyses), and even in the machine room at Playchess.com. They appear in your GUI just like local engines.

The installation does not overwrite your Fritz 13 but creates an additional installation of that beta interface version.
